Transaction 629b4daf043ce61fa1928aaf19f19769915392e61bb83ba7f6ad51188e779985
1 Input
1 Output
-
629b4daf043ce61fa1928aaf19f19769915392e61bb83ba7f6ad51188e779985:0
- value
- 20158922
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9a25815c115003b07d6230af8ecfefce4f93eb91 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1F43zTUx1PoMoTjX3dgmTmMn3B8NBFeVHt